The development of any competitive technology has always been marked by a headlong rush by competitors in the field to achieve before others. The dash to develop workable nuclear power plants (no matter what their energy was employed to do) certainly saw this phenomenon from the late 1940s onward. In June we celebrate the anniversary of the first commercial power plant to be placed on the grid anywhere. It was not in the United States. It was in the Soviet Union.

Yesterday, the Nuclear Regulatory Commission announced that its commissioners had approved the award of a Construction and Operating License (COL) for DTE Energy's prospective Fermi Unit 3, to be built on the site of the existing Fermi-2 near Detroit, Mich. The COL will also notably be the first for the GE Hitachi ESBWR, or "Economic Simplified Boiling Water Reactor," a Gen-III+ nuclear plant with passive safety.

As I've discussed in many previous ANS Nuclear Cafe posts (see: How Can Nuclear Construction Costs be Reduced & Cost/Benefit Analyses of Nuclear Requirements), my belief is that the primary reasons for the lack of nuclear power's growth/success are the extremely burdensome requirements and regulations. They are vastly more strict than those applied to competing sources, in terms of dollars spent per life saved, or amount of environmental impact avoided. For various (non-scientific) reasons, nuclear is held to standards that are orders of magnitude higher than those applied to competing sources.
Last week, it was revealed publicly that a Draft Resource Plan being floated by the Tennessee Valley Authority (TVA) includes the presumption that the long-unfinished Bellefonte nuclear plant near Scottsboro, Alabama, will not be completed. TVA's nuclear energy history will span 50 years this June, and there are developments in the works with Bellefonte and one other TVA plant to be mentioned later. All are now expected to shake out this year, and may preface the final volume of that long up-and-down history.

This morning at twenty minutes after nine, the historic nuclear barge Sturgis began what will surely be the final voyage in its life. Shut down since 1976 and unneeded, the barge is being towed to Texas where it will ultimately be completely dismantled and scrapped.
